Our Story

The Saginaw Valley Naval Ship Museum was established in 1997 to bring the USS EDSON (DD 946) to Bay County's riverfront. This unique military and maritime museum honors those who have defended the nation's freedom while promoting Bay City’s rich shipbuilding heritage.

Impact

As an international destination, the museum educates current and future generations about America's history, traditions, and values. It is recognized as the #1 local tourist destination on Trip Advisor, making a significant impact in the Saginaw Bay Region.
